In the case of Power of Attorney you do, you have to register it with the Office of the Public Guardian. You have to send off the form together with the appropriate fee. Once this has been done and no-one objects to the registration (which Ben could do of course), the Public Guardian must register it. They must do this after three weeks. The Public Guardian must notify the donor once it is registered. As you can see this process actually takes some time.
Signing over the business to Max however is instantaneous.Once Ben's signed the contract in front of a witness it becomes legally binding immediately. so there is no chance of Sharon ever being able to beat Ben to it.
